As technology advanced, each PlayStation generation brought a wave of innovation. The PlayStation 2 era is often hailed as the pinnacle of console gaming, hosting some of the best games ever made. With over 150 million units sold, the PS2 remains the best-selling console in history, and its library reflected that success. Titles like God of War, Shadow of the Colossus, and Grand Theft Auto: San Andreas pushed the limits of what was technically possible at the time. They offered sprawling worlds, deep narratives, and memorable characters that made every session feel like an event. These PlayStation games became more than just entertainment; they were artistic expressions of creativity and ambition.
The rise of the PlayStation 3 and PlayStation 4 continued this legacy with even more cinematic storytelling and realistic graphics. The Last of Us, Uncharted 4: A Thief’s End, and Bloodborne became industry-defining masterpieces. They showed how PlayStation games could deliver emotion, challenge, and immersion on a level few competitors could match. Sony’s focus on exclusive titles and narrative-driven gameplay distinguished it from other platforms and helped cement the PlayStation ecosystem as a haven for serious gamers who valued quality over quantity.
Even the portable line — especially the PSP — left an indelible mark. PSP games like Crisis Core: Final Fantasy VII, God of War: Chains of Olympus, and Monster Hunter Freedom Unite proved that handheld gaming could deliver console-level experiences on the go. The PSP’s sleek design and multimedia capabilities were ahead of their time, offering music, movies, and gaming all in one device. Though the handheld line has since evolved into the PS Vita and beyond, the legacy of PSP games remains deeply respected by collectors and enthusiasts worldwide.
